A free initial consultation with a seasoned lawyer is the first step to take in a mesothelioma claim. The lawyer will go over the case and determine whether you are eligible for a claim. This will be determined by several factors, such as the amount of exposure to asbestos and the type illness you contracted.

If you have a mesothelioma diagnosis your attorney will have to review your medical records and work history to determine the cause of your exposure to asbestos. They will also check to determine if you are eligible for VA benefits. The VA provides monthly payments and medical care to veterans who have been exposed to asbestos while in the military.

A mesothelioma-related lawsuit could take 2-3 years to resolve. This is due to the fact that a lawsuit requires extensive research, filing and court hearings. Additionally there are state laws that are known as statutes of limitations which limit the length of time required to make a claim.

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its settle in a settlement, rather than a court verdict. This is because victims and their families don't want to go through a long and stressful trial. The firms will do everything they can to ensure that their clients receive the highest settlement they can.

Mesothelioma victims can receive compensation for lost income, medical expenses, and suffering. Families can also get the wrongful death award when loved ones die from mesothelioma. Additionally, mesothelioma patients can file a claim with the Veteran's Administration to obtain disability compensation.

The value of a mesothelioma claim is determined by a variety of factors, including how much time the victim had to live with the disease, the age at which they were diagnosed, and their mesothelioma stage. Each case is different, and it is difficult to determine the amount a mesothelioma victim will receive in a trial or settlement.

Attorneys who specialize in mesothelioma are able to assist veterans in obtaining VA disability benefits, as well as asbestos trust fund claims. Veterans can access more than $30 billion in asbestos trust funds without needing to appear in a courtroom. Mesothelioma sufferers and their families can also file a lawsuit for personal injury or wrongful death against asbestos companies who put their health at risk.

Mesothelioma lawyers do not typically charge upfront fees. Instead, they will work on a contingency basis, meaning that they only be paid if you succeed in your case. The amount that your lawyer receives will usually be an amount that is a percentage of the total settlement or verdict. Be aware that there are other options for attorney fees, like hourly or flat rates.

A mesothelioma case can be filed against multiple defendants. The defendants could be manufacturers, insurers, or any other parties who knew they had exposed their customers to asbestos. The plaintiff must show that the defendant breached their duty of care and failed to take reasonable steps to protect their employees from exposure to asbestos. The plaintiff must then prove that the breach led to their injuries, including mesothelioma being diagnosed. Expert testimony is usually required to establish liability and decide monetary damages. Expert testimony must prove the negligence of the defendant, which led to the diagnosis of mesothelioma, as well as other injuries.
